The main purpose of this study is to investigate the safety of the study drug known as LY3039478 and evaluate two different formulations of LY3039478 in healthy participants. Part A has three periods. Either LY3039478 or placebo will be given once by mouth in each period. Part B has two periods. Participants will receive both formulations of LY3039478, by mouth, over the course of the study. Both parts of the study will also explore how much LY3039478 gets into the bloodstream and how long it takes the body to get rid of it. Information about any side effects will also be collected. Participants may only enroll in one part. The study will last at least 33 days, not including screening. Screening must be performed up to 30 days before enrollment.
Part B was added by protocol amendment approved in April, 2016.

PK: mean time-matched difference in QTcF interval with time-matched concentrations between LY3039478 capsule formulation (formulation 3) compared to placebo. Analyses of QTcF was assessed by the mean change in QTcF as a function of plasma drug concentration. Triplicate measures at each time point was averaged prior to analysis. The primary analysis was based on the time-matched placebo-adjusted QTcF (ΔQTcF) for each time point, which was calculated by subtracting each participant's time-matched placebo QTcF from their QTcF results after receiving LY3039478. The relationship between plasma concentrations of LY3039478 and ΔQTcF was evaluated using a linear mixed-effects modeling approach. The response variable was ΔQTcF, and concentrations was fitted as a fixed effect with participants as a random effect. The regression slope was presented with the unit in "milliseconds per nanogram per milliliter" abbreviated as "ms/ng/mL".
